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Merstham to Snaith start from as little as £45.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Merstham to Snaith start from £76.10 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Merstham to Snaith are available for £161.20 one way

Station Facilities and Ticketing

At Merstham station, securing your travel tickets is a breeze. The ticket office is open from 06:10 to 19:35 from Monday to Saturday and on Sundays from 08:30 to 16:40. For your convenience, there are also ticket machines available, including those specifically designed to accommodate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. Additionally, smartcard facilities are available, ensuring you're all set for a hassle-free journey.

Help & Support

Should you require assistance, help points are conveniently located throughout the station. Staff are on hand to offer support during designated hours throughout the week. Although there is no luggage storage, be assured that CCTV coverage is in place to enhance security within the premises.

Accessibility

Merstham station strives to be accessible to all passengers. While step-free access is available, the routes can vary, and it's advisable to check maps or contact the station staff for the best routes to suit your needs. Assistance can be pre-booked, or you can take advantage of the turn-up-and-go service, which facilitates spontaneous travel options.

Onward Travel Options

For onward travel from Merstham station, you'll find various transport options that ensure you remain connected. Taxis can be easily accessed outside Platform 1, while local bus services are also available with helpful information on routes provided at the station. In the event of any service disruptions, a rail replacement service ensures your journey is uninterrupted.

Facilities and Amenities at Snaith Station

Upon arrival at Snaith station, you will notice a simplicity that speaks to its rural charm. There is no ticket office or self-service machines available here, so it's advisable to plan ahead and purchase your tickets online before your journey. Though the lack of such amenities might seem inconvenient, it adds a nostalgic aspect to your travels — evoking memories of simpler times.

Accessibility is a strong point for Snaith Station, boasting step-free access across its single platform. While the station is unstaffed, travelers who require assistance are encouraged to wait on the platform where train conductors can lend a hand. This station offers step-free transitions, ensuring ease of travel for those with mobility challenges. Keep an eye out for the 360 map to explore more about the station’s layout. The induction loop is available for individuals who require hearing support.

Onward Travel Options

For those looking to continue their journey beyond the station, Snaith offers a convenient bus service. A bus stop is situated just outside the station, providing local routes to nearby towns and villages. For more information about bus services, call their hotline at 0871 200 2233, ensuring you have all necessary details for an uninterrupted journey.

Taxi services are available through Northern Railway's partnered site, Cab4You, making it easy to arrange transport directly from Snaith station to your final destination. With taxi services complementing the absence of car parking facilities, transit to and from the station remains straightforward and efficient.
